The spire of one of the tallest Gothic cathedrals in the world is currently engulfed in flames. It is known that the fire broke out in the part of the building where construction work was underway. The cause of the fire is still being determined.

BFM TV footage shows a dark column of smoke rising from the spire of Rouen Cathedral. All visitors to the cathedral were evacuated.

“We had to attach hoses (…) to get water for the fire hose 120 metres up.” Lieutenant Colonel Eric Tyrelle explains how the fire brigade managed to contain the fire in Rouen Cathedral.
The Gothic cathedral in the French city of Rouen was built in the 12th-16th centuries. The metal spire of the cathedral was built in the 19th century. The height of the cathedral is 151 meters. It is included in the list of national heritage of France.
April 15, 2019 A fire broke out in Notre Dame CathedralIn two hours, the flames that broke out on the restorers' scaffolding destroyed the Gothic spire, stained glass windows and brought down the roof.
